Radeon RX 9070 vs G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op: In-Depth Breakdown
Performance: Radeon RX 9070 vs G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op
The Radeon RX 9070 is dramatically faster, around 105% ahead of the G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op. That gap is enough to move it up a tier: the Radeon RX 9070 is comfortable at 4K with upscaling and native 1440p, while the G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op is better matched to 1080p.
Power & Efficiency
On power, the G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op is the gentler choice at 115W versus 220W. The Radeon RX 9070 is more efficient per watt because it's faster, but its higher 220W draw means more heat and a bigger PSU.
VRAM & Future-Proofing
The Radeon RX 9070 carries 16GB versus 8GB on the G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op. The extra 8GB helps at 4K, with high-resolution texture packs, and for content-creation or local-AI workloads that exhaust smaller buffers.
Features & Ecosystem
Beyond raw numbers, the G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op brings NVIDIA DLSS upscaling/frame generation and stronger ray tracing, while the Radeon RX 9070 offers AMD FSR upscaling and strong rasterization value. If you lean on upscaling or ray tracing, that ecosystem difference can matter as much as the frame-rate gap.

Technical Specifications Comparison
Architecture & Cores
| Specification | G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op | Radeon RX 9070 |
|---|---|---|
| Architecture | Blackwell | RDNA 4 |
| Process Node | TSMC 4NP | TSMC N4 |
| CUDA Cores (CUDA Cores / Stream Processors) | 3,840✓ | 3,584 |
| Ray Tracing Cores | 30 | 56✓ |
| Tensor / AI Cores | 120✓ | 112 |
Clock Speeds
| Specification | G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op | Radeon RX 9070 |
|---|---|---|
| Base Clock | 1,410 MHz✓ | 1,330 MHz |
| Boost Clock | 2,340 MHz | 2,520 MHz✓ |
Memory
| Specification | G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op | Radeon RX 9070 |
|---|---|---|
| VRAM Capacity | 8 GB | 16 GB✓ |
| Memory Type | GDDR7 | GDDR6 |
| Memory Bus | 128-bit | 256-bit✓ |
| Memory Speed | 28 Gbps✓ | 20 Gbps |
| Bandwidth | 448 GB/s | 644.6 GB/s✓ |
Connectivity & Power
| Specification | GeForce RTX 5060 Laptop | Radeon RX 9070 |
|---|---|---|
| Interface | PCIe 5.0 x8 | PCIe 5.0 x16 |
| TDP | 115 W✓ | 220 W |
| Power Connectors | None | 2x 8-pin |
| Released | Jan 2025 | Mar 2025 |
